Output 7105456176089f23530ca6b6d9596f5b5b3f38dd0075d0327dcad77d16adcf7c:9

value
1003854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be09629a78a12ccfac24b33383a105cf3d520e0d OP_EQUAL
address
3K1qZ5rfUdwtjvFVWAFcfaQrKQdZqRFd3S
transaction
7105456176089f23530ca6b6d9596f5b5b3f38dd0075d0327dcad77d16adcf7c
spent
true